Output 78ecafb5fab680f6bc611e4bea9b3bc1521268bbbb2f9e8d19e96a94bc2bd9f2:0

value
30807855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1720d14ebdff8c29a14dd9329b8ab39d3fecacc1 OP_EQUAL
address
33oJnARJwAF7Ar9TUp4RfHPmqVkrZADhDd
transaction
78ecafb5fab680f6bc611e4bea9b3bc1521268bbbb2f9e8d19e96a94bc2bd9f2
confirmations
329472
spent
true